> The Fsubstitute_command_keys function is indeed a bit hairy, and I
> agree that a conversion to Lisp is the most reasonable next step.
> 
> I've actually been working a patch to convert it to Lisp for Bug#8951,
> but it's not finished yet.  The difficulty is that it has a couple of
> helper functions that also needs to be lifted, which makes the job
> bigger than just the function Fsubstitute_command_keys.
> 
> My goal is to get the Lisp version to produce the same output as the C
> version, which currently seems to be a feasible goal.  Once it's in
> Lisp it should be easier to make further improvements, fix bugs, etc.

Maybe we should first talk a bit about why Lars you think it would be
"pretty trivial" to keep properties in Lisp, but not in C.  I'm
probably missing something very basic here, because I don't see why
it would be easier in Lisp.
